A crowdfunding campaign to raise money for victims of this weekends horrific Orlando nightclub shooting has raised almost $2.1 million in slightly over 27 hours, becoming both the largest and the fastest-funded campaign in GoFundMes six-year history, the site confirmed this afternoon.
The campaign was launched by Equality Florida, the states largest LGBT rights group, which is aiming to collect $2 million for victims and their families. As of this writing, nearly 50,000 people have donated. That includes major donations from California Lt. Gov. Gavin Newsom, Executive Pride and Cricket Wireless, as well as thousands of smaller donations from individual people and businesses.
Every penny raised will be distributed directly to the victims and their families, the organization said in a statement. We are working with a team of attorneys and experts, including the National Center for Victims of Crime, which deployed funds in both Chattanooga and Aurora, to ensure funds are distributed correctly.
